Detroit and Kennedy are places in Alabama.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

Kennedy has the higher population (504 vs 230 in Detroit). Kennedy has the higher median household income ($42,031 vs $16,250 in Detroit). Kennedy has the higher median home value ($103,400 vs $76,800 in Detroit).
